Terps Sign Three Recruits To National Letters Of Intent

Nov. 25, 2002

COLLEGE PARK, Md. - Maryland women's golf coach Jason Rodenhaver announced the signing of three high school seniors to National Letters of Intent for the 2003-04 season.

The three recruits who have signed with the Terrapins are Kelly MacWhinnie from Upper St. Clair High School in Pittsburgh, Pa., Jessica Reno from St. Mark's High School in Wilmington, Del., and Katie Stepanek from Guilford High School in Guilford, Conn.

"I am very happy with this class. I think they will be a good fit at Maryland," Rodenhaver said. "They are good students and good players, and I think they will fit right in and play right away and take the place of the seniors who are leaving."

Team captain Erin Clasper (North Potomac, Md.), Carter Crowther (Kilmarnock, Va.), Jennifer Gibson (Havertown, Pa.) and Holly Thornton (Delran, N.J.) comprise the Terps' first full four-year senior class. All four have been with the Terrapins since the program's inception in 1999 and will graduate after the season.
